A Tiny Treasure: The Vintage Perfume Ampule

A Scent from the Past

Do you remember watching your mother get ready for a night out? She’d reach into her handbag and pull out a tiny glass vial. With a quick flick of a lighter, the room would fill with a soft, heavenly scent.

This wasn’t just any perfume. It was a perfume ampule—also called a perfume nip.

Glamour in a Glass Shell

From the 1950s through the 1970s, these miniature vials symbolized beauty and charm. Women carried them everywhere to feel glamorous on the go. Even if the scent faded by day’s end, the moment it was applied felt magical.

Slim and elegant, these ampules tucked neatly into any purse, ready for quick touch-ups.

What Made Ampules Special

Unlike bulky perfume bottles, ampules offered convenience and style. Made of fragile glass, each held just enough fragrance for one or two uses.

Both ends were sealed. To release the scent, you’d snap off the tip and dab the perfume on. No mess. No fuss. Just pure elegance in a single motion.

Beauty with Purpose

Perfume ampules didn’t just smell lovely—they looked stunning. Some featured wax seals or vibrant colored tips. Each one felt like a miniature work of art.

Using an ampule was more than a beauty routine. It was a graceful ritual. A moment of sophistication captured in glass.

Reflecting a Changing World

After World War II, women’s lifestyles shifted. They were busier, more independent, and always on the move. Beauty products had to keep up.

That’s where ampules came in—portable, refined, and modern. Unlike the large bottles that sat on vanities, these vials fit into purses, desk drawers, or evening clutches with ease.

As fashion magazines boomed, ampules gave everyday women a touch of movie star glamour.
